I tested this method out and it worked. But not in the way you can say successful. Put horse blankets, newspapers, bubblewrap...its all the same difference. All you're doing is quieting the vibration by placing a space between two objects. Does not actually dampen, or provide any of the actual audible performance increases true methods gain.

This is very much like a guy I know who puts napkins in his rear deck and dash to stop the vibrations...lol.

I understand people on a budget. If you are short on cash, and don't mind low quality, go for it. But if you're only running a couple hundred watts and are not conpeting, I don't see why not.

Not hating, just a true fan who knows cutting corners isn't always good. Then again, my daily driver is about 14000 watts. If I was broke and needed deadening, I would use expanding foam and elemental designs has some nice $1 a sq ft damplifier you could use sparingly and add more as you buy it.

go to lowes or home depot and get peel and seal. it does work, if you use 2+ layers of it. get a couple few rolls of it and go to town. i live in northern ohio and it gets a lil cold and warm here, and i've had no problems with it at all, and it helps a lot, i have 4 layers on each door, and 2-3 everywhere else, and it helped tremendously.
